Marie-Monique DUCHESNE was born 1 May 1808 in Les Éboulements, Lower Canada

Marie-Monique DUCHESNE was the child of Joseph DUCHESNE   and   Madeleine TREMBLAY and the grandchild of: (paternal)  Jean-Baptiste-Augustin DUCHESNE and Francoise FILION (maternal)  Louis TREMBLAY and Victoire SAVARD

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Marie-Monique  married  Louis GAUTHIER 16 January 1827 in Les Éboulements, Lower Canada .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Louis GAUTHIER  was born 26 July 1802 in Les Éboulements, Québec, Canada (Notre-Dame-de-l'Assomption-des-Eboulements).  Louis died 1 January 1875 in Les Éboulements, Québec, Canada (Notre-Dame-de-l'Assomption-des-Eboulements).  Louis was the child of Louis GAUTHIER (GONTHIER) and Procule BOUCHARD.

Marie-Monique DUCHESNE died 29 January 1886 in Les Éboulements, Québec, Canada .

Did You Know? Québec Généalogie - Over time, Québec has gone through a series of name changes
From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
